My teaching style is very simple, but is one that took a long time to learn. In college you are taught everything but HOW to teach. I learned the HOW by watching my teachers and having some very good mentors. I began to ask myself, " why do I learn more from this instructor than that instructor?" No matter what the subject is, you have to learn 2 things to reach the student. One, how does this student learn. Two, you can't force the information. I feel that a student learns more and shows more excitement when they are allowed to find answers on their own. This also takes building a relationship with the student.
